πŸ“– Ghosted Bot Documentation

Learn how to use Ghosted Bot's powerful automation tools effectively. Below is a list of available commands, their usage, and required variables. Please note, all commands with an asterisk require leadership permissions in the Discord.

βš™οΈ Activity Module

Commands related to tracking clan activity.

βœ… /activity

Report your activity status.

/activity status:Active/Inactive game:OSRS/RS3/Both
                

πŸ“‹ /checkactivity *

View the list of inactive members.

/checkactivity game:OSRS/RS3/Both
                

πŸ›  /setactivity *

Manually update a member's activity status.

/setactivity clanmember_id:DISCORD_USERID status:Active/Inactive game:OSRS/RS3/Both
                

πŸ›  Developer Module

Commands for bot maintenance and debugging.

πŸ“‘ /ping *

Checks the bot's response time to Discord’s servers.

/ping
                

♻️ /reload *

Reload a specific cog.

/reload cog:SELECT_COG
                

πŸ“Š /status *

Provides bot uptime, server details, and loaded cogs.

/status
                

πŸ”„ /sync *

Reload all cogs.

/sync
                

πŸ’° Donations Module

Commands for logging and tracking donations.

πŸ’Ž /donate *

Log a new donation.

/donate game:OSRS/RS3 donator_id:DISCORD_USERID amount:1K/1M/1B
                

πŸ“œ /ledger *

Update the clan bank balance.

/ledger game:OSRS/RS3 amount:1K/1M/1B
                

πŸ’Έ /spend *

Log an expenditure and update activity.

/spend game:OSRS/RS3 amount:1K/1M/1B reason:ENTER_REASON
                

πŸ“… Events Module

Commands for creating and managing events.

πŸ“’ /event *

Creates an event and tags necessary roles.

/event game:Discord/OSRS/RS3 timestamp_start:UNIXTIMESTAMP 
event_title:ADD_TITLE location:ADD_LOCATION event_description:ADD_DESCRIPTION

Optional:

host_id:DISCORD_USERID side_image:URL banner_image:URL 
timestamp_end:UNIXTIMESTAMP hex_color:HEXCODE
                

πŸ—“ /event-create *

Creates a new event such as a competition or bingo.

πŸ“Œ /event-register

Registers a clan member for an active event.

πŸ“Έ /event-submit

Upload an image submission for an event.

πŸ“° News Module

Commands for posting news updates.

πŸ“ /news *

Create a news post.

πŸŽ– Promotions Module

Currently under construction.

πŸ“– Report Documentation Module

Commands for maintaining clan member records.

πŸ” /pullthatup *

Retrieve documentation records for a clan member.

❌ /removefromwatchlist *

Removes clan member entries from the watchlist.

πŸ“ /writethatdown *

Create a new documentation record for a clan member.

πŸ”— /writethatdown-merge *

Merge two JSON files together.